pectic substance

noun

Medical Definition of PECTIC SUBSTANCE

:  any of a group of complex colloidal carbohydrate derivatives of plant origin that contain a large proportion of units derived from galacturonic acid and include protopectins, pectins, pectinic acids, and pectic acids
